链路追踪CAT如何解决系统瓶颈?
在当今数字化时代,企业对系统性能的要求越来越高。然而,随着系统复杂度的增加,系统瓶颈问题也日益突出。如何解决这些问题,提高系统性能,成为了企业关注的焦点。本文将重点介绍链路追踪技术CAT如何解决系统瓶颈,提高系统性能。
一、系统瓶颈问题
系统瓶颈是指系统中存在的一个或多个性能瓶颈,导致整个系统无法达到预期性能。常见的系统瓶颈问题包括:
- CPU瓶颈:CPU处理能力不足,导致系统响应缓慢。
- 内存瓶颈:内存资源紧张,导致系统频繁进行页面交换,影响性能。
- 磁盘I/O瓶颈:磁盘读写速度慢,导致数据传输效率低下。
- 网络瓶颈:网络带宽不足,导致数据传输速度慢。
- 数据库瓶颈:数据库查询效率低,导致系统响应时间长。
二、链路追踪技术CAT
链路追踪技术(CAT,Chainlink Tracing)是一种用于分布式系统性能监控和故障排查的技术。它通过在系统各个组件之间传递链路信息,实现对整个系统性能的实时监控和故障定位。
- 工作原理
CAT的工作原理如下:
(1)在系统各个组件中,通过添加CAT客户端,实现链路信息的收集和传递。
(2)当某个组件执行一个操作时,CAT客户端会记录该操作的链路信息,包括操作名称、开始时间、结束时间等。
(3)链路信息通过CAT服务器进行集中存储和分析,实现对整个系统性能的监控。
- 优势
(1)实时监控:CAT能够实时监控系统性能,及时发现系统瓶颈。
(2)故障定位:通过链路信息,快速定位故障发生的位置,提高故障排查效率。
(3)性能优化:根据监控数据,分析系统瓶颈,进行针对性的性能优化。
三、链路追踪技术CAT解决系统瓶颈案例
- CPU瓶颈
某企业采用CAT技术对系统进行监控,发现CPU使用率过高。通过分析链路信息,发现CPU瓶颈主要来自于某个业务模块。经过优化该模块,CPU使用率得到显著降低。
- 内存瓶颈
某电商平台采用CAT技术监控系统性能,发现内存使用率过高。通过分析链路信息,发现内存瓶颈主要来自于数据库查询。优化数据库查询策略后,内存使用率得到有效控制。
- 网络瓶颈
某企业采用CAT技术监控系统性能,发现网络带宽利用率低。通过分析链路信息,发现网络瓶颈主要来自于某些节点之间的数据传输。优化网络配置后,网络带宽利用率得到显著提升。
四、总结
链路追踪技术CAT能够有效解决系统瓶颈问题,提高系统性能。通过实时监控、故障定位和性能优化,CAT为企业提供了强大的系统性能保障。在数字化时代,企业应充分利用CAT技术,提升系统性能,为用户提供更好的服务。
猜你喜欢:云原生APM